I have the head hanging shame of admitting that I was a bit of a bully in senior school. It is not something I am proud of and not something that I will ever say is right.

I then had to watch my poor daughter experience the awful trauma of being bullied, it was a nightmare for her and us. It was pretty bad and we had to have the police involved but luckily she has come through it a much stronger, braver more confident young woman. She was so brave and it humbled me to see what she went through and know I had done similar to another person.

I think that schools should try to do more, every school has to by law have an anti bullying policy, but what use is it if the school are not sure how to put it into practice. Luckily my daughters school were very proactive but I know that is often not the case.
